A State Trooper, also known as a Highway Patrol Officer or State Police Officer, plays an integral role in the law enforcement industry by enforcing laws on highways and interstate systems, assisting local law enforcement agencies, and performing police duties within their respective state. Their responsibilities include patrolling assigned areas, investigating accidents, responding to emergency calls, arresting suspects, and testifying in court. State Troopers also assist in disaster relief and control traffic during emergencies. They often work directly with the public, providing assistance and information.

Before becoming a State Trooper, individuals may serve in roles such as Police Officer, Correctional Officer, or Security Guard. These roles provide the necessary experience in law enforcement, public safety, and dealing with potentially dangerous situations. Important skills for a State Trooper include physical stamina, interpersonal skills, perceptiveness, and leadership skills. State Troopers must be U.S. citizens, hold a valid driver's license, and be at least 21 years old. They also need to complete a state-approved police academy training program and pass physical fitness, background, and written tests. Additionally, certification in first aid and CPR is beneficial.
